Designing a curriculum that guarantees success for every student isn’t easy. Students are different. They have different interests and abilities, and they learn in different ways. A one-size-fits-all curriculum doesn’t always work. That’s where 360 High School comes in. 360 High School opened in 2018 as an alternative to the traditional one-size-fits-all curriculum. From the beginning, the school was designed with the input of faculty, community organizations and students. At 360 High School, students work with faculty to create a unique learning plan that takes into account their individual abilities, passions and learning style. This means students work at their own pace and have a variety of options to demonstrate what they’ve learned. This could mean taking a test, or it could mean giving a presentation or building a model. Students meet regularly with their teachers to go over their daily, weekly and annual goals, with discussions focused on how to achieve these goals, expectations and progress. Involving students in the process generates excitement, motivation and successful learning. 360 High School enrolls approximately 300 students. All students receive a Chromebook to help them with their schoolwork. A special feature of 360 High School is the participation of community partners in the classroom — for instance, a coding class co-taught by Brown University computer science students. Extracurricular activities, including field trips, are available, as are clubs, athletics and student council.

The GreatSchools Rating helps parents compare schools within a state based on a variety of school quality indicators and provides a helpful picture of how effectively each school serves all of its students. Ratings are on a scale of 1 (below average) to 10 (above average) and can include test scores, college readiness, academic progress, advanced courses, equity, discipline and attendance data.
